Not a Member?
NCRPA Contacts
Full Contact Information is published in every issue of StateShots as the “NCRPA Directory.” Feedback from the website addressed to an individual or a title will be forwarded to that individual or post.
Association Officers and Discipline Chairs
President 2026 David McFarling, Chapel Hill NC
Vice President 2026 Sam Summey, Flat Rock NC
Secretary 2026 Nick Wind, Charlotte NC
Treasurer 2026 Eli Colotta, Charlotte NC
Publicity Chair 2024
Director of Legislative Issues Dennis Allen
Public Relations 2024
Director 2025 Tyrone Phillips
Director 2025 H.J. “Walt” Walter, Flat Rock NC
Director 2025 Ralph Carson, Garner, NC
Director 2026 Tom Willats, Wake Forrest NC
Director 2026 Clark Hardesty, Greensboro NC
Director 2026 David Prest, Pinehurst NC
Director 2027 John Ayala
Director 2027 Savannah Andrews
Director 2027 Mike Greno
Past President Fred Edgecomb, Kurie Beach NC
Smallbore Rifle Keith Miller, Cary NC
Precision (Bullseye) Pistol, Clark Hardesty
Gun Show Coordinator, David Fitzmoris, Goldsboro NC
High Power Rifle, David McFarling, Chapel Hill NC
Junior Rifle Team, David McFarling, Chapel Hill NC
Hunter Safety, Rick Swaim, Dobson NC
NRA Training Counslor, Eric Shuford, Cary NC
Tournaments, David McFarling
Range Development, Mark Terry
Law Enforcement Liaison, Brian Silva
Membership Chairman, David Prest
Youth Programs, David Prest
NRA Rep – Eastern NC, Nate Cantrell
NRA Rep – Western NC, RJ McFarland 919-935-2549 rmacfarland@nrahq.org
NRA Board Member, Edie Fleeman
NRA Board Member, H.J. “Walt” Walter
NRA Board Member, Mark Robinson